Centenary College of Louisiana vs. University of St Thomas Cost Comparison

Which college is more expensive, Centenary College of Louisiana or University of St Thomas? Published tuition is the sticker price; many students pay less after aid (see average net price below).

  • The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at University of St Thomas than Centenary College of Louisiana ($20,599 vs. $25,953).
  •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at University of St Thomas are 26.8% lower than at Centenary College of Louisiana ($10,840 vs. $14,800).
  • Centenary College of Louisiana is 19% more expensive for in-state tuition than University of St Thomas (about $6,566 more per year; $41,200.00 vs. $34,634.00).
  • Out-of-state tuition is 19% higher at Centenary College of Louisiana than at University of St Thomas (about $6,566 more per year; $41,200.00 vs. $34,634.00).
  • A larger share of students receive grant aid at Centenary College of Louisiana than at University of St Thomas (100% vs. 93%).
  • The average total grant financial aid received by Centenary College of Louisiana students is 39% larger than aid received by University of St Thomas students ($34,617 vs. $24,902).

Centenary College of Louisiana vs. University of St Thomas Admissions comparison

Which college is harder to get into, Centenary College of Louisiana or University of St Thomas? Typical SAT and ACT scores (same estimates as in the table above), middle 50% test ranges where reported, test score submission policy, deadlines, and acceptance rates summarize admission difficulty between University of St Thomas and Centenary College of Louisiana.

  • The typical SAT score (median estimate) at Centenary College of Louisiana (1140) is 40 points higher than at University of St Thomas (1100).
  • Incoming Centenary College of Louisiana students have a 1 point higher typical ACT composite (median estimate) (22 vs. 21 at University of St Thomas).
  • Reported middle 50% SAT composite range (25th-75th percentile) for admitted students: Centenary College of Louisiana 1060/1210; University of St Thomas 980/1210.
  • Reported middle 50% ACT composite range (25th-75th percentile) for admitted students: Centenary College of Louisiana 20/25; University of St Thomas 18/25.
  • Submitting SAT or ACT scores: Centenary College of Louisiana - Test optional; University of St Thomas - Test optional.
  • Typical fall application deadline: Centenary College of Louisiana Dec 15, 2026; University of St Thomas Aug 15, 2027.
  • Accepted freshman Centenary College of Louisiana students have a 0.03 point higher average high school GPA (3.56) than students at University of St Thomas (3.53).
  • University of St Thomas has a higher acceptance rate (89.9%) than Centenary College of Louisiana (55.7%).
  • The share of admitted students who enrolled (yield) is 24.3% at Centenary College of Louisiana vs. 29.7% at University of St Thomas.

Centenary College of Louisiana vs. University of St Thomas Graduation Outcomes Comparison

How do outcomes compare for Centenary College of Louisiana and University of St Thomas? Graduation rate, earnings, and student loan debt are common indicators. The bullets below summarize the same federal outcomes fields as the comparison table (College Scorecard / IPEDS where applicable).

  • Centenary College of Louisiana's six-year graduation rate (58%) is higher than University of St Thomas's (44%).
  • Graduates from University of St Thomas earn a median of about $4,700 more per year than Centenary College of Louisiana graduates about ten years after starting college ($57,200 vs. $52,500), per the same Scorecard earnings definition.
  • Among federal student loan borrowers, University of St Thomas graduates have a $4,000 lower median loan debt than Centenary College of Louisiana graduates ($22,000 vs. $26,000).
  • Among borrowers, University of St Thomas graduates have an estimated $41 lower median monthly federal student loan payment than Centenary College of Louisiana graduates ($227 vs. $268).
  • More Centenary College of Louisiana graduates are actively paying back their federal student loan debt than former University of St Thomas students, three years after graduation. (66% vs. 59%)
